Photograph Information Photographer's Comments
Challenge: Apple II (Basic Editing)
Camera: Nikon D90
Lens: Nikon MF Micro-Nikkor 55mm f/3.5 AI
Location: Toronto, Ontario
Date: Feb 7, 2009
Aperture: f/8
ISO: 200
Shutter: 1/125
Galleries: Macro, Food and Drink
Date Uploaded: Feb 8, 2009

This pic is trickier than you would think,,, the problem with taking a pic of an apple is that you don't want it to be shiny, and also, the apple is round, so it's tough to get the drips to stay there and not roll off... the trick that I figured out when taking this pic was to rub Vaseline all over the apple, then pretty much wipe most of it off... this gives it a dull sheen so that the sight source doesn't reflect too much, and also it allows for large water drips to bead up nicely and stay where you put them without rolling off =)

The light source is an AlienBees B400 flash head with a 24x36 softbox from behind... the tripod was about 5 feet away and 4 feet high, with the head tilted at approx and angle of depression of about 45-60 degrees... this back-lighting is what makes the drips look so nice...
